探索iOS相机界面中取景框从黑色渐变为透明的视觉奥秘
在使用iPhone原生相机应用时,你可能注意到:刚打开相机时,取景区域周围有一圈深色(接近黑色)遮罩;当你开始对焦或轻触屏幕后,这个遮罩会逐渐变为透明,使画面更沉浸。
这种设计不仅提升了视觉焦点,还增强了用户操作的反馈感。
下面是一个模拟iPhone取景框从黑色过渡到透明的简单CSS动画效果。将鼠标悬停在方框上,即可看到变化:
虽然原生iOS相机使用的是Swift和UIKit实现,但在Web前端中,我们可以通过以下方式模拟类似效果:
div.overlay)设置初始 background: rgba(0,0,0,1)transition 实现透明度平滑过渡这种设计兼顾了美学与功能性,是现代移动UI的典型范例。
苹果在人机界面指南(Human Interface Guidelines)中强调“内容优先”原则。初始黑色遮罩有助于:
当用户完成对焦或调整曝光后,系统认为用户已准备好拍摄,于是移除遮罩,呈现完整画面。